Lunch & Learn, Differential Pressure Measurement Seminar

The Lunch & Learn seminar is an excellent way to enhance your personnel’s knowledge about differential pressure (dP) flow elements with minimal interruption to your limited schedule.

Our Sales Managers come to your location to supply a customized presentation, typically over your lunch hour and can cover a variety of subjects.

The seminar is well suited for design engineers, instrumentation and process control engineers, technicians, plant operators and systems personnel.

Provided is an introduction to dP type fluid flow meter primary devices along with a selection of related subjects specific to your particular industry.


Municipal common water cycle uses include: Raw water intake, water treatment plant processes, potable water distribution, wastewater collection, wastewater treatment process control, and plant effluent.

Industrial uses are common throughout a vast range of fluid applications, a short list: plant water and steam, cryogenic, chemical and natural gas.

An excerpt of beneficial subjects that can be covered are listed below. Specialized application topics can also be prepared.
